Family
madre, padre, hermano, hermana
A1 Spanish family vocabulary covers the basic members of the family:
- Madre (mother)
- Padre (father)
- Hermano (brother)
- Hermana (sister)
- Hijo (son)
- Hija (daughter)
- Abuelo (grandfather)
- Abuela (grandmother)

Close Relationships
Esposo, esposa, novio, novia
For romantic and marital relationships, use:
- Esposo / Esposa (husband/wife)
- Novio / Novia (boyfriend/girlfriend; also used for fiancé/fiancée)
- Pareja (partner/couple)

Friendship & Affection
Amigo, amiga, cariño
- Amigo / Amiga = Friend (male/female)
- Conocido / Conocida = Acquaintance
- Cariño = Affection, sweetheart (also used as a term of endearment)

Common Phrases
Tener, ser, estar, querer
- Tener (to have): "Tengo dos hermanos." (I have two brothers.)
- Ser (to be - permanent): "Él es mi padre." (He is my father.)
- Estar (to be - temporary/location): "Mi madre está aquí." (My mother is here.)
- Querer (to love/want): "Quiero a mi familia." (I love my family.)
